Web Perfomas Assignment
After reading the proformas that we are provided with I have extracted faculty, department, student, course, entities, room and organization entities which are major entities of the assignment and rest of the 4-5 entities are mentioned in ERD of the assignment. In this assignment i have designed web forms for the major entities and some login mechanism for both faulty members and students to provide them to access to records is also designed. For impressive assignment, the knowledge of best books are important.
To design the database I designed and define business logic myself where I have don’t get any idea about business rules. For example, one department may have many teacher and one teacher may belong to many department. But it can be considered as one teacher can belong to one department and one department can have many teacher. Anyhow the total entities are 11 in numbers.
Database file is created in appdata folder and forms are located in view folder and the controller of these web forms are in controller class. All of the forms are handled on the sample web application of the default MVC project of visual studio